 Peru, Nebraska- As part of Peru State College’s ongoing mission to engage community members, it has released a calendar of nineteen on-campus events open to the public in February 2016. Two extra events – one in January and one in March - have been added as a convenience.

Other events open to the public and added to the calendar will be announced via social media and a press release.

About Peru State College: Peru State’s “Campus of a Thousand Oaks,” an arboretum, is nestled in historic southeast Nebraska. The state’s first college, Peru State offers a unique mix of innovative online and traditional classroom undergraduate and graduate programs, including online graduate degrees in education and organizational management. It is a college of choice fostering excellence and student achievement through engagement in a culture that promotes inquiry, discovery and innovation.
